Container volume
Long Beach container volume (TEU)
Monthly loaded imports, loaded exports and empties at the Port of Long Beach, in TEU
Data through May 2026 · page updated Jul 10, 2026

- Loaded imports
Loaded imports at Long Beach were 418,851 TEU in May 2026, up 40% year over year and up 44% versus the same month of 2019. Loaded imports are the import-demand read; empties are repositioned boxes. This is the latest month published, not the current week.
| Stream | Latest (May 2026) | MoM | YoY | vs 2019 |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Loaded imports | 418,851 TEU | +7.4% | +40.0% | +44.1% |
| Loaded exports | 109,168 TEU | -8.2% | +32.9% | -9.5% |
| Empty containers | 297,918 TEU | +2.1% | +22.9% | +89.0% |
About Long Beach container volume (TEU)
This page tracks monthly container volume at the Port of Long Beach in TEU, twenty-foot equivalent units, split into loaded imports, loaded exports and empty containers. Loaded imports are the demand signal a US importer watches; empties are a tell about trade imbalance and equipment. The numbers are the port authority's own, re-published by BTS, and they land weeks after the month they cover, so a reading here is the latest month available rather than the current week.
